This article explores how popular metaverse platforms like The Sandbox, My Neighbor Alice, and Decentraland are transforming the virtual space, offering new opportunities for interaction and earning.

The Sandbox: Empowering Players with Decentralized Creativity

The Sandbox allows players to own and sell simple voxel art and even entire games using Ethereum tokens in the form of NFTs. Through the SAND token, users can purchase land, build assets, and engage in governance. The platform offers a unique autonomy for users, setting it apart from traditional platforms and enabling players to create immersive experiences and earn rewards.

My Neighbor Alice: Farm, Trade, and Earn with Ease

My Neighbor Alice combines elements of farming, fishing, and animal breeding. Virtual farms can be turned into assets using the ALICE token, which facilitates purchases and voting. The game incorporates DeFi elements like staking tokens and trading assets, appealing to both crypto enthusiasts and casual gamers.

Decentraland: Unlock the Virtual Land Ownership

Decentraland allows users to purchase and build virtual land. The platform turns web assets into unique spaces for interaction, entertainment, art, and gaming. All properties are owned by players who share the principles of a player-built economy.

The Sandbox, My Neighbor Alice, and Decentraland showcase how the metaverse can transform interactions and ownership of virtual assets. These platforms open new frontiers for creativity and financial independence in the gaming industry.
